What are 3 actions which demonstrate a brokers unethical conduct? - Correct Answer- to sell more insurance than is needed, to sell higher priced coverages when equivalent coverage is available for a lower price, to recommend policies with a higher commission. What are 3 qualities of a professional? - Correct Answer-commitment to higher ethical standards, have a high standard of educational preparedness with mandatory continuous education, have a formal association regulating power over its members What responsibilities do brokers owe their clients? - Correct Answer-to provide coverage best suited to the client, to hold the affairs of clients in strict confidence, to be competent and diligent. What responsibilities do brokers owe insurers? - Correct Answer-to abide by the agency agreement, to adhere to binding authority, to deal honestly with money and to disclose all material facts What responsibilities do brokers owe fellow brokers? - Correct Answer-to use fair methods of solicitation, to encourage public respect and to not harm the reputation of a fellow broker State 3 common E&O causes - Correct Answer-inadequate coverage, misrepresentation and description errors, cancellation and renewal errors Provide 4 examples of inadequate coverages - Correct Answer-failure to provide proper coverage, failure to advise of restrictions/exclusions, failure to provide coverage, mistake in coverage Provide 3 examples of renewal errors - Correct Answer-not renewing at all, not renewing with adequate coverage, not warning of pending expiry State 3 instances where brokers would be held liable to the insurer for claims paid due to misrepresentation - Correct Answer-where the insurer would not have accepted the risk, where the insurer may not have accepted the risk, where the insurer would have accepted but with higher premium What are 5 things brokers can do to reduce E&O's? - Correct Answer-ensure all staff are acting within their scope of competence, take all steps to determine clients' needs, be advisers; not deciders, know coverages & insurers, stay within binding authority

What are 5 procedures to reduce E&O's while claim handling? - Correct Answer-report the claim immediately, inform client of their responsibilities, do not authorize repairs, if the loss is clearly not insured; advise them, follow up What is the key source of broker credibility in an E&O claim? - Correct Answer- documentation Provide 2 examples of record keeping that help defend E&O claims - Correct Answer- conversation & telephone logs, letters of confirmation What does E&O insurance cover? - Correct Answer-coverage is provided for claims that arise out of any negligent act, error or omission of the broker or its employees while acting as an insurance broker What is not covered on E&O policies? - Correct Answer-Dishonest, fraudulent or criminal acts Define "Step Licensing" - Correct Answer-a system that requires a higher degree of knowledge for each increasing step Define "Ethics" - Correct Answer-the principles of conduct governing an individual or group Define "Professionalism" - Correct Answer-a professional is one who possesses a special skill or knowledge Define "Self Regulation" - Correct Answer-The right of an industry to govern its own affairs
